Targeting Inflammation: The Science Behind Cryo Therapy's Efficacy
Inflammation is a natural response from the body to injury, but it can prolong healing and hinder performance recovery. Cryotherapy for joint pain leverages the power of cold temperatures to target and reduce inflammation effectively. The science behind its efficacy lies in the rapid cooling process that triggers a cascade of physiological reactions. When the affected area is exposed to extreme cold, blood vessels constrict, reducing blood flow to the injured tissues. This minimizes the delivery of inflammatory mediators and metabolic byproducts that contribute to pain and swelling.
Additionally, cryotherapy induces a temporary decrease in muscle tissue temperature, which slows down cellular metabolism and suppresses inflammatory responses. This controlled freezing process allows for faster healing as it promotes the formation of new, healthy cells while minimizing damage caused by excess inflammation. By addressing joint pain and swelling at their root cause, cryotherapy offers athletes an innovative solution to speed up recovery and regain optimal performance.
Integration into Training Regimes: Optimal Timing and Benefits
Cryotherapy, or cold therapy, has gained popularity in the sports industry as a valuable tool for injury prevention and recovery. When integrated into training regimes, cryotherapy offers a strategic approach to managing joint pain and accelerating healing processes. The optimal timing for its application is during and after intense workouts or competitions, when inflammation and muscle soreness are at their peak. By immersing the affected areas in cold temperatures, athletes can experience reduced swelling, diminished pain, and enhanced recovery.
Regular inclusion of cryotherapy sessions in training routines can provide long-term benefits, such as improved endurance, faster reaction times, and better overall performance. It helps athletes maintain a competitive edge by minimizing the risk of overuse injuries, which are common in high-intensity sports. This method is particularly beneficial for joint health, as it promotes blood flow to the affected areas while reducing metabolic waste products, ensuring optimal conditions for tissue repair and regeneration.
